FAQs for booking flights from Belfast to Zermatt

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Belfast Intl Airport to Zermatt?

    When flying out of Belfast Intl Airport you’ll be using Belfast Intl. Zermatt does not have its own airport so you’ll be flying into nearby Geneva Geneve-Cointrin airport, which is 79.9 mi away.

  • How long does a flight from Belfast Intl Airport to Zermatt take?

    Direct flights cover the 793 miles separating Belfast Intl Airport and Zermatt in about 2h 10m.

  • How many flights are there between Belfast Intl Airport and Zermatt?

    1 direct flights run between Belfast Intl Airport and Zermatt on a daily basis. On average, there are about 9 departures each week.

  • What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ly between Belfast Intl Airport and Zermatt?

    Consider leaving on a Friday and avoid Tuesdays if you're looking for the best rates. For your return to Belfast Intl Airport, you’ll find the best rates on Tuesdays and the most expensive ones on Sundays.
